Output 466abf23a77d0d23f3f8b8666215c300389fdafce2d7144ff15353da17503a8c:1

value
2638960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18841a7a40db33ea462c69ab67b4770869ef1312 OP_EQUAL
address
33vePrXhegmawiFadCrgw3bSKmCiexNY59
transaction
466abf23a77d0d23f3f8b8666215c300389fdafce2d7144ff15353da17503a8c
spent
true